打造高效安全的比特币钱包接口:工程师的全方

              引言:钱包接口的重要性

              在这个数字货币迅速发展的时代,比特币已经成为了一种广泛接受的资产。而比特币钱包则是存储和管理这些数字资产的关键工具。在这个背景下,开发高效且安全的钱包接口显得尤为重要。作为一名工程师,掌握比特币钱包接口的设计与实现,不仅能帮助您在数字货币领域立足,也能提升金融科技的整体安全性和用户体验。

              比特币钱包接口的基本概念

              打造高效安全的比特币钱包接口:工程师的全方位指南

              在深入了解比特币钱包接口之前,我们需要从基本概念出发。比特币钱包接口,简单来说,就是用户与比特币网络交互的桥梁。通过这个接口,用户可以发送、接收比特币,查询账户余额等。

              这与传统银行系统中的API类似,但要涉及更多的安全机制与加密技术。钱包接口的设计不仅要考虑功能的实现,还需要关注安全性,以防止黑客攻击或用户的资产被盗。

              接口架构设计

              一个优秀的比特币钱包接口应该具备简洁且清晰的架构。以下是构建比特币钱包接口时需要考虑的几个关键点:

              1. 选择合适的开发语言

              在开发比特币钱包接口时,选择合适的编程语言至关重要。常用的语言有Python、Java和Node.js等。这些语言具有丰富的库和框架,可以帮助加速开发过程,并提高最终产品的质量。

              2. 设计RESTful API

              使用RESTful风格设计接口,可以让用户更方便地进行操作。RESTful API能够支持JSON格式的数据交流,便于前端与后端的互动。同时,确保接口遵循HTTP的标准,使得接口更具可访问性。

              3. 防止常见的安全漏洞

              安全性是比特币钱包接口设计中的重中之重。在设计时,一定要防范常见的安全漏洞,例如SQL注入、跨站脚本攻击和重放攻击。可以通过输入数据验证、频率限制和HTTPS加密等手段来提升安全性。

              用户体验至上的设计理念

              打造高效安全的比特币钱包接口:工程师的全方位指南

              一个好的钱包接口,不仅功能齐全,更要关注用户体验。用户在使用比特币钱包时,所要经历的每一步都应该是简单直观的。

              1. 清晰的用户界面设计

              用户界面的设计应该使用明亮、易读的字体,并且在重要操作例如发送比特币时,提供明确的提示和确认步骤。这不仅可以减少用户的操作错误,还能提升使用的信任感。

              2. 提供详细的说明和帮助文档

              用户在使用钱包接口的过程中,可能会遇到各种问题。因此,提供详细的使用说明和帮助文档,可以有效提升用户的满意度。确保所有API的请求和响应都附有详细注释,便于用户和开发者理解和使用。

              案例分析:成功的钱包接口设计实例

              为了更好地理解比特币钱包接口的设计,我们可以分析一个成功的案例。比如有一个名为XWallet的钱包应用,它通过精致的用户界面和高效的后台处理而受到用户的青睐。

              XWallet在接口设计上,遵循了上述关于架构和用户体验的原则。同时,它引入了区块链技术,以保证交易的透明性和安全性。用户不仅可以方便地进行交易,还能实时查看交易记录,体验非常顺畅。

              工程师的角色与责任

              作为比特币钱包接口的工程师,您的角色不仅仅是开发者,更是用户的守护者。要时刻保持对安全性的关注,确保所有用户的数据和资产都能得到妥善的保护。

              同时,工程师还需不断学习和更新对区块链技术及其相关安全知识的认识,保持警觉,以应对日益复杂的网络攻击和安全威胁。

              总结:持续学习与创新

              比特币钱包接口的设计是一个复杂而又充满挑战的任务。然而,随着技术的不断进步与发展,作为一名工程师,您要不断提升自我,保持对新兴技术的敏感度与学习热情。

              在未来的数字货币环境中,钱包接口将扮演更加重要的角色。希望通过本指南,您不仅能够理解钱包接口的基础理论和实现方法,更能掌握其中的实践技能,帮助用户实现更加安全、便捷的数字资产管理。

              相关问题探讨

              比特币钱包接口的安全性怎样才能得到保障?

              安全性是比特币钱包接口面临的最大挑战之一。在设计与开发阶段,有几个关键措施可以加强安全性:

              • 采用多重签名技术:通过要求多个用户的批准才能完成交易,可以大大增加安全性。
              • 实现实时监控系统:实时监控交易活动可以迅速发现可疑行为,并及时采取措施。
              • 数据加密:使用加密技术保护用户的数据和交易信息,防止未授权的访问。

              此外,定期的安全审查和更新也是保持钱包接口安全性的重要手段。只有持之以恒,才能为用户提供一个安全可靠的钱包环境。

              如何提升比特币钱包接口的用户体验?

              提升用户体验是每一个工程师长久以来追求的目标。以下几个策略可以帮助提升钱包接口的用户体验:

              • 简化操作流程:通过简化用户的操作步骤,可以有效减少用户的困惑。例如,可以通过引导式界面帮助用户完成复杂的交易。
              • 提供个性化服务:根据用户的历史交易记录和行为,提供个性化的推荐和服务,使用户感受到被重视。
              • 多语言支持:为了服务全球用户,提供多种语言的界面可以扩大用户基础,并提升用户满意度。

              在数字货币的快速发展中,用户体验的提升需要技术与人性化关怀相结合,创造更好的使用平台,为用户带来持续的价值。

              通过以上的详细解析与探讨,我们可以看到,作为比特币钱包接口的工程师,既要具备扎实的技术基础,又要关注用户的体验与需求。只有这样,才能真正做到创新与安全并存,为用户提供卓越的服务。
                author

                Appnox App

                content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                    related post

                                      leave a reply